pudar info.

Tips to Remember the Indonesian Word:
– To remember "pudar," you can associate it with the word "powder" in English, as things that are faded can sometimes look like they've been dusted with a light powder.

Explanations:
– "Pudar" is an adjective in Indonesian that describes something that has lost its color or brightness, similar to the English word "fade." It can be used literally to describe colors, or metaphorically to describe things like memories that have become less vivid over time.

Other Words That Mean the Same Thing:
– Luntur
– Meredup
– Memudar

Conjugations:
– Since "pudar" is an adjective and not a verb in Indonesian, it does not have verb conjugations. However, you can create verb forms from the root by using affixes:
– Memudarkan (to cause something to fade)
– Memudar (to fade)

Examples of Sentences:
– Warna bajunya sudah pudar setelah sering dicuci. (The color of the shirt has faded after being washed frequently.)
– Kenangan itu semakin pudar seiring berjalannya waktu. (That memory fades more and more with time.)
– Lukisan di dinding sudah mulai pudar karena terkena sinar matahari. (The painting on the wall has started to fade due to sunlight exposure.)
